Corrosion, the insidious degradation of materials due to environmental factors, poses a significant threat to infrastructure, industrial equipment, and consumer products. To mitigate this pervasive issue, various protective layer technologies have been developed to enhance corrosion resistance. These coatings act as a barrier between the underlying material and the corrosive environment, effectively inhibiting or slowing down the degradation process.
- Organic coatings offer a versatile range of options, providing chemical resistance to corrosion. These coatings can be applied in various thicknesses and are often enhanced with additives to improve their durability and performance.
- Metallic coatings provide exceptional durability against corrosive agents. They are frequently employed in corrosive settings where organic coatings may not be suitable.
The selection of the most appropriate coating technology depends on factors such as the properties of the substrate material, the severity of the corrosive environment, and the desired level of protection. Understanding Corrosion Mechanisms: A Guide to Prevention
Corrosion processes are often complex and multifaceted, involving a intricate combination of factors such as environmental conditions, material composition, and applied stresses. A thorough understanding of these elements is essential for developing effective corrosion prevention strategies.
One critical aspect is identifying the specific type of corrosion that impacts a given material. Common types include pitting, crevice corrosion, stress corrosion cracking, and galvanic corrosion. Each type has distinct characteristics and requires tailored control measures.
Using preventive measures can significantly prolong the lifespan of metallic structures and components. These measures may include surface treatments such as painting, galvanizing, or applying protective coatings; material selection based on corrosion resistance; environmental control measures like reducing humidity or controlling pH levels; and regular assessments to detect early signs of corrosion.

Corrosion Prevention Strategies in Industrial Environments
Industrial environments pose substantial challenges to equipment integrity due to the presence of corrosive agents. Implementing effective corrosion prevention strategies is crucial for minimizing downtime, lowering maintenance costs, and ensuring maximum operational performance. A multi-faceted approach covers various methods, such as the selection of robust materials, the application of protective coatings, and the implementation of operational controls to mitigate corrosive influences. Regular evaluation and timely restoration are also crucial for sustaining corrosion protection over the long term.

Advanced Coating Solutions for Difficult Applications
In the realm of material science, coating technologies are constantly evolving to meet the ever-growing demands of diverse industries. From extreme environments to intricate designs, innovative coatings provide crucial protection, functionality, and aesthetics. This article explores some of the most groundbreaking coating solutions designed for challenging applications, showcasing how these advanced materials are pushing the boundaries of performance and reliability. One area of focus is the development of coatings that can withstand harsh conditions, such as high temperatures, corrosive chemicals, or abrasive wear. These specialized coatings often incorporate ceramic components to create robust barriers against environmental degradation. Moreover, researchers are exploring novel coating techniques like atomic layer deposition and plasma spraying to achieve unprecedented precision and control over the coating's thickness and properties.
These innovative solutions are transforming industries ranging from aerospace and automotive to electronics and biomedical engineering, enabling the creation of lighter, stronger, more durable, and environmentally friendly products.
